Introduction

The purpose of this paper is to analyze the damages, methodologies and fee apportionment decisions in published decisions from The International Centre for the Settlement of Investment Disputes ("ICSID"). This article includes a description of damages methodologies used in ICSID disputes as well as an empirical analysis of their use. Also included is an analysis of interest calculation methods as well as decisions by tribunals related to the division of arbitration fees.
